6983005060 - Window regulator OE number by TOYOTA
Replacement parts compatible with OE numbers
We can deliver replacement part to your door in
United Kingdom
on 22 November
£62.56
Dispatch on next business day
£102.55
Dispatch on next business day
£67.11
Dispatch on next business day
£97.05
dispatch in 28 business days
£50.38
dispatch in 28 business days
£71.12
dispatch in 28 business days
£58.85
dispatch in 28 business days